Naming Your LLC in Louisiana


Before submitting any paperwork, you'll have to choose a unique and compliant name for your Louisiana LLC that adheres to state regulations.

Check the state's business directory to ensure your selected name is available. Your LLC name must include “Limited Liability Company” or abbreviations like “L.L.C.” or “LLC”.

Stay clear of terms that infer government ties or demand specific authorization, like “bank” or “insurance”. Be cautious of restricted and prohibited terms.

Once you’ve secured an available name, you can hold it online for 60 days if you’re not immediately form your LLC right away.

Selecting a Registered Agent for Your Louisiana LLC


Once you’ve settled on a name for your Louisiana LLC, the subsequent step is to appoint a registered agent.

The registered agent serves as the main contact for your LLC with state authorities. This person or business must have a real address in Louisiana and be available during normal business hours to accept legal documents and government notices on your LLC's behalf.

Consider appointing yourself, another reliable individual, or a dedicated service. Remember, your registered agent’s address enters public record, so many entrepreneurs opt for a service for privacy.

Choosing a credible agent assures critical communications and meetings are not overlooked.

Submitting the Articles of Organization for Your Louisiana LLC


After you've selected your registered agent, it's time to officially create your Louisiana LLC by submitting the Articles of Organization with the Secretary of State.

You'll require basic details, including your LLC's name, address, registered agent particulars, and the names of stakeholders or managers.

The form may be filed digitally or through postal service, incurring a mandatory fee—ensure to verify the exact fee on the Secretary of State's official site.

Once you lodge your Articles, anticipate approval; review times may vary.

When approved, you'll receive a stamped copy of your filing, confirming your LLC is officially formed and ready for subsequent steps.

Developing a Robust Operating Agreement for Your LLC


Although Louisiana doesn't mandate an operating agreement, creating one is a wise move for your LLC. The agreement provides a clear outline of your business's structure and ownership.

It helps prevent misunderstandings among members and clarifies responsibilities, profit sharing, and decision-making protocols. In it, you cover how to manage membership changes, disputes, and LLC termination if necessary.

An operating agreement also demonstrates your business’s legitimacy to banks and investors. Even if you’re a sole LLC, having this agreement demonstrates professionalism and foresight, resulting in smoother operations.

Take the time to draft a clear, custom agreement for your Louisiana LLC.

Ensuring Compliance with Louisiana’s Legal and Tax Obligations


Following the drafting of your operating agreement, attend to meeting Louisiana's ongoing compliance obligations.

Every year, obligatory Annual Reports are to be filed with the Secretary of State, with relevant fees, to preserve your LLC's status. Always maintain a registered agent in Louisiana and ensure your business information is up to date.

Regarding taxes, acquire an EIN from the IRS. Depending on your LLC’s activities, you may need additional state tax accounts or secure specific business licenses.

Be sure to fulfill both state and federal tax requirements as applicable. Ensuring compliance preserves your LLC's here status and viability.
